Question for you guys with these rims.
I bought these rims back in sept. of 07 to replace my chromies. Currently I am running 195/50/15's on all 4 corners of my 63 ghia, my plan was to run 145's on 4.5 wheels and keep the 195/50/15's for the back on 5.5 rims.  I got the 145's today and had them mounted on the 4.5's.  When I went to put them on the ghia the lugs were too long, they hit the brake shoes, I called a vw place and they said to back the lugs out and use loc tite, that seems crazy. 
I was going to cut the lugs but the grease cap sticks out too far on the rim, so I am looking for spacers.  Any ideas?
As for the back, I was hoping to run 195's but now I think they probably won't fit if I find a way to space them out.  not to mention that the 145's are 2.5" taller than the back 195's so I'm now planning on 195/65/15's.

as far as the lugs either cut them Down or get shorter ones if cutting them down pull the drum off and bolt the wheel to it the lug should come all the way  flush with the inside of the Drum, What year is your Ghia? if it pre 60 the front Drums are 3/4 of an inch longer so it puts the grease cap out there  you can change the front drums to 61 to 65 which have a shorter collar on them the spindle lenght is the same just the drums are different  I Dont think you can get a 5.5 Brm under the rear fender on a ghia MWS wheels have a different offset then the Flat 4's which are 5 inch wide
